THERE have been no new coronavirus related hospital deaths for eight days NHS figures reveal.

The latest figures, announced by the NHS today (June 4), show no Covid related deaths in Worcestershire Acute Hospitals NHS Trust, with its total remaining at 808.

There have also been no new deaths in Worcestershire Health and Care NHS Trust, with its figure remaining at 63.

In all settings, which includes hospices and care homes, the total number of deaths during the pandemic is at 1,356.

Worcestershire Acute Hospitals Trust covers Worcestershire Royal Hospital, as well as the Alexandra Hospital in Redditch and Kidderminster Hospital.

Worcestershire Health and Care NHS Trust covers community hospitals and rehabilitation wards, including Worcester City Impatient Unit, Malvern Community Hospital, Evesham Community Hospital, Pershore Community Hospital, the Princess of Wales Community Hospital in Bromsgrove, Tenbury Community Hospital and the Wyre Forest Ward.
